Как начать с PHP на Ubuntu - PullRequest
3 голосов
/ 06 марта 2011

Я новичок в PHP.Я успешно установил PHP на Ubuntu, теперь я хочу запустить свою первую программу.Я использую gPHPEdit в качестве IDE.Где я должен сохранить .php файлы, которые я создаю?И как их запустить / проверить?

Ответы [ 4 ]

4 голосов
/ 07 марта 2011

Убедитесь, что у вас установлено LAMP.Сделайте sudo tasksel и выберите лампу, затем нажмите Enter, она должна быть самой простой из * установленных усилителей.Хорошая идея установить phpmyadmin: sudo apt-get install phpmyadmin.После этого просто скопируйте файлы в /var/www/, и тогда они появятся в http://localhost.Я рекомендовал использовать Eclipse PDT или сборку Netbeans для PHP.

1 голос
/ 16 декабря 2014

удалить файл index.html из /var/www/

$ sudo rm index.html

создайте там новый php-файл:

$ sudo gedit /var/www/index.php

напишите в нем:

<?php
print_r(phpinfo());
?>

Перезагрузите сервер Apache2:

$ sudo service apache2 restart

OR

$ sudo /etc/init.d/apace2 restart

и укажите на свой локальный хост и /index.php

если возникнет ошибка, посетите: http://www.allaboutlinux.eu/how-to-run-php-on-ubuntu/

1 голос
/ 09 ноября 2014

Если вы не можете сохранить или скопировать в var / www / html, запустите ваши php-скрипты в браузере.Если вы используете Ubuntu 14.04.Я следовал за этими шагами, и это работало для меня.

  1. Выполнить sudo su на терминале.
  2. Введите свой пароль
  3. Выполните sudo subl /etc/apache2/sites-available/000-default.conf на своем терминале, чтобы открыть этот файл.Обратите внимание, что вы можете изменить subl на любой текстовый редактор, чтобы открыть файл, например, sudo nano /etc/apache2/sites-available/000-default.conf.
  4. Измените DocumentRoot /var/www/html на /home/user/yoursubdir
  5. Сохраните файл и закройте его.
  6. Выполните sudo subl /etc/apache2/apache2.conf на своем терминале, чтобы открыть этот файл.
  7. Добавьте следующее в конец файла

    <Directory /home/user/>
        Options Indexes FollowSymLinks
        AllowOverride None
        Require all granted
    </Directory> 
    
  8. Сохраните и закройте файл.

  9. Выполнить sudo service apache2 restart
  10. Зайдите в браузер, введите URL своего скрипта, например 127.0.1.1/directory/document.php.

Надеюсь, это поможет.

1 голос
/ 06 марта 2011

Вы должны взять книгу или начать следовать некоторым хорошим учебникам в Интернете.
Если вы просто пишете сценарии с использованием php, вы можете сохранить их где угодно и запустить php на терминале с помощью интерпретатора командной строки php.
Если вы пытаетесь написать веб-сценарии (и я так думаю), вам необходимо установить и настроить веб-сервер (обычно apache) и сохранить свои сценарии в корневом каталоге документов сервера (обычно / var / www). Кроме того, я настоятельно рекомендую вам немного прочитать о серверах и HTTP и выяснить, как все это работает изнутри, прежде чем учиться создавать сайты в php.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...